Transaction 62d594d73af3070e49ccd5ed783414962cb332c0ceee0ef9bd94223e1eb1e9ff
1 Input
1 Output
-
62d594d73af3070e49ccd5ed783414962cb332c0ceee0ef9bd94223e1eb1e9ff:0
- value
- 32112930
- script pubkey
- OP_0 OP_PUSHBYTES_20 0273f185f0f88bc520765b819662534c954e875f
- address
- bc1qqfelrp0slz9u2grktwqevcjnfj25ap6lw7s0da